Movie characters kill hundreds of henchmen but think they are too good to kill the main bad guy.

This has always annoyed me in media. The "good guy" will murder hundreds of guards and thugs but then when it comes to the main "bad guy" suddenly it is immoral to kill him. Logically if you're going to mow down countless people (probably just trying to feed their families) you might as well take out the villain. Otherwise, you're saying the super evil guy's life is more valuable than his employees.
